Haglund, Alice E.
Age 88 of Minneapolis, MN formerly of Hibbing and Nashwauk. Passed away peacefully at 12:14 PM, Monday, September 13, 2010 at her residence in Minneapolis.
She was born April 9, 1922 in Hibbing, MN. The daughter of Albert George and Alice (Hannula) Trembath. Alice lived with great resolve. She lived each day with a loving and enthusiastic spirit. Everyone she touched truly felt her love and kindness. Alice left this world as she lived in it, conscious of God, her love for the Bible, her ascension and reunion with passed love ones in heaven, at peace, and surrounded by her family and friends. Alice was a member of the Hibbing High School band, and the National Honors Society. She graduated from Hibbing High School in 1940, Hibbing Junior College in 1942, and graduated with honors from Northwestern Institute of Medical Technology in Minneapolis, MN in 1944.
Alice was united in marriage to Rudolf "Rudy" Haglund on September 10, 1946 in Hibbing. They settled in Nashwauk in 1946 where she worked alongside Dr. Kenneth Ahola of Hibbing and Dr. Robert Kelly of Grand Rapids at the Nashwauk Clinic. She worked as a medical technologist at the Eastern Itasca Clinic and the Itasca Memorial Hospital in Grand Rapids. In 1966 Alice worked again, with Dr. Ahola at the Mesaba Clinic in Hibbing, after retiring in 1978, by invitation and with unwavering family support, she returned to work at Fairview Mesaba University Medical Center until 1987.
She was a member of Wesley United Methodist Church in Hibbing and Fridley United Methodist Church in Fridley. Also a member of Jobs Daughtera�(TM)s, a past matron of the Nashwauk OES 277, and a member of the order of Easter Star Mesaba 211. A timeless volunteer to Range Helping Hands, Shrine Hospital, North Star Hospice, Range Creative Art Center, Range Seniors and numerous non profits.
